Osagyefo Oliver Barker Vormawor, Lawyer and Human Rights activist, has shown serious concerns about the arrest and detention of the Bono Regional NPP Chairman, Hon. Kwame Baffoe Abronye.

According to him, the said case filed against the Bono Regional NPP Chairman is so embarrassing, and the ongoing trial must be stopped at once!

Kwame Baffoe Abronye was invited to the Criminal Investigative Department(CID) headquarters to come and answer some questions relating to a video he made about a High Court Judge, claiming the judge is politically biased.

He was arrested and has been remanded in custody by the Adenta Circuit Court to the National Investigations Bureau until the final determination of his case.

Lawyer Barker Vormawor commented on this issue on Facebook, posting the court’s Charge Sheet in the case of Abronye Dc, and said, “File Nolle Prosequi in the matter! This is just embarrassing. Shalom!”

He continued his statement in a different post, in which he hit the president on the shoulder, and the leaders of the National Democratic Congress(NDC) party, to not take these rampant arrests for granted, as it will turn back to harm them in the future.

“The NDC must not take these rampant speech-related arrests for granted oo. Yoo. They quickly undermine support for a government,” he said.

Lawyer Barker later called on the Attorney General of the land to quickly intervene in the trial of Abronye Dc, and exercise executive order to prevent the Police from applying the Electronic Communications Act 2008, Section 76 or Section 208, which criminalize the use of electronic means to misinform and disinform.

“I think the Attorney General must urgently issue an Executive Instrument to limit the prosecutorial mandate of the police to no longer cover Section 208 or Section 76 of the Electronic Communications Act,” he stated.

He then stressed the fact that speech criminalization must not be a practice performed by the police, which intends to put Democracy and Freedom of Speech under siege, but must only be a reserve decision of the Attorney General’s Department.

“End these speech criminalization by an overzealous police force. Reserve a decision to charge a person over such offences to the AG’s department directly. A word to worse. Shalom!”

What we know about Abronye DC’s case.

Abronye Dc has been arrested and detained by the Adenta Circuit Court for alleging that the Adenta Circuit Court is politically influenced, and the judge who presides over cases is politically biased.

Prior to his arrest, the Minority group in parliament, NPP, has issued a letter expressing their dissatisfaction concerning how their party communicators are been treated unfairly under this current administration, demanding the release of Abronye.

Dr. Mahamadu Bawumia, the flagbearer of the NPP ahead of the 2028 General Elections, in a recent statement, has condemned the use of the judiciary to intimidate his people, calling on the president to stop putting democracy and free speech under siege.
